How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kingwood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
77345 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,644 | $1,271 | $2,766 |
77345 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,055 | $1,865 | $2,508 |
77345 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,523 | $2,295 | $2,750 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 77345 ZIP Code
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 77345?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 77345 range from $1,230 to $4,524,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,865 to $2,508.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,295 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,298.
